当前位置: 首页 > 专利查询>SAP股份公司专利>正文

用于业务网络管理发现和合并的系统和方法技术方案

技术编号:7373852 阅读:168 留言:0更新日期:2012-05-28 06:29
根据一些实施例,可以在网络景观中发现多个互连的实体。然后所述实体的子集可以被自动地合并到业务参与者中,所述合并可以根据至少一个基于规则的算法来执行。然后,包括业务参与者的业务处理景观可以被生成和/或显示给操作者。

【技术实现步骤摘要】
用于业务网络管理发现和合并的系统和方法
一些实施例涉及业务(business)网络管理。更具体地,一些实施例与来自多个源的数据和元数据的发现和/或合并相关联,以创建系统和应用彼此集成的集成网络,并且从业务处理角度描述它们之间的交互。
技术介绍
企业内的集成开发可能要求对现有应用、系统、和/或接口的理解,以方便以一致的方式在它们之间进行通信。例如,集成中间件应用可以使能应用到应用(“A2A”)集成、业务到业务(“B2B”)集成、和/或电子数据交换(“EDI”)通信。这些中间件应用可以让应用实现面向服务的体系结构(“SOA”)和事件驱动体系结构(“EDA”)原理(principal),并帮助组织(orchestrate)跨越企业内的不同应用的业务处理。在一些客户景观(landscape)中,还可能存在多种软件实例(来自多个软件卖商)执行这样的任务。例如,软件实例可以被布置为中央集线器或者嵌入在应用系统中。为了帮助方便集成开发,可以通过在客户的景观中描述系统和应用(包括那些系统和应用的各种表现)以及经由中间件应用在它们之间的集成来制定(mapout)网络。然而,创建这样的网络图或景观可能是耗费时间并且是容易出现错误的处理。例如,从技术和业务角度两者而言,集成中间件应用可能不提供景观的准确视图(view)。这样视图不仅在操作网络时是有用的,而且对于实现未来的网络改变和/或增强而言也是需要的。
技术实现思路
因此,可以根据这里描述的一些实施例提供用于自动和有效地确定业务处理景观的方法和机制。附图说明图1是根据一些实施例的业务网络管理景观的框图。图2示出根据一些实施例的业务网络管理景观。图3是根据一些实施例的包括可以探索网络的网络管理服务器的系统的框图。图4是根据一些实施例的业务网络管理处理的流程图。图5示出根据一些实施例的合并的网络模型。图6示出根据一些实施例的另一级的合并的网络模型。图7是根据一些实施例的合并处理的流程图。图8是示出根据一些实施例的与系统相关联的传出和传入呼叫的图形。图9是示出根据一些实施例的来自系统的传出呼叫的图形。图10是示出根据一些实施例的系统通信的图形。图11是根据一些实施例的与系统相关联的融合(merged)的图形。具体实施方式在企业内的集成开发可能要求对已有应用、系统、和/或接口的理解,以方便以一致的方式进行它们之间的通信。例如,集成中间件应用可以使能A2A集成、B2B集成、和/或EDI通信。这些中间件应用可以让应用实现SOA和EDA原理,并帮助组织跨越企业内的不同应用的业务处理。在一些客户景观中,还可能存在多种软件实例(来自多个软件卖商)执行这样的任务。例如,软件实例可以被布置为中央集线器,或嵌入在应用系统中。为了帮助方便集成开发,可以通过描述客户景观中的系统和应用(包括那些系统和应用的各种表现)以及经由中间件应用在它们之间的集成来制定网络。例如,图1是根据一些实施例的业务网络管理景观100的框图。景观100包括许多互连的系统110。例如,系统110可以包括彼此通信的业务应用和/或服务器。请注意,系统110的子集120、130、140可以在业务意义上被分组在一起。例如,一个子集120可以与总部业务处理相关联,而另一个子集130与分配中心处理相关联。然而,创建这样的网络图或景观100可能是耗费时间和容易出错的处理。例如,从技术和业务角度二者来看,集成中间件应用可能不提供景观的准确视图。这样的视图不仅在操作网络时是有帮助的,而且还可以是实现未来的网络改变和/或增强所需要的。根据一些实施例,可以基本上实时地来构建关于从网络角度从不同类型的已有(并且运行的)生产系统(例如,应用和/或中间件)搜寻的集成网络的信息,这是具有企业的每天的业务处理的最新信息。例如,集成网络可以定义为经由在物理硬件系统上运行的业务应用彼此交互的业务参与者的网络。例如,图2示出根据一些实施例的包括三个业务参与者220、230、240(例如,分别对应于图1的子集120、130、140)的业务网络管理景观200。根据一些实施例,可以基于已有应用和/或中间件系统中可用的信息为客户景观自动地构建这样的集成网络。例如,所述信息可以包括以下各项中的一些或全部:应用系统概观(例如,与应用服务器或数据库相关联)、产品版本、连通性信息、在中间件系统或应用系统上运行的集成、接口、集成处理模型、操作数据、业务处理描述、业务角色和参与者、业务对话(conversation)、和/或业务协作。请注意,本实施例并不限于信息的这些示例。而且,在一些实施例中,可以准许一定量的操作者干预。也就是说,网络景观可以被“自动地”确定,即使当操作者提供一些信息时(例如,系统名称和别名)。请注意,当相同信息具有多种表现时(例如,由于信息在不同领域中的使用),应用和系统的异质性(heterogeneity)可以成为因素。例如,关于系统的信息可以在应用和中间件系统中具有一个表现,对于IT操作具有另一个表现,并且作为处理建模的参与者具有再一个表现。还请注意,各种工具可以提供可用于构建网络景观的元信息。例如,系统管理工具、IT操作工具、监控和IT操作工具、根成因分析和事故管理工具可以分别收集监控和操作数据,以使管理者分解和操作系统。这些工具可具有一些受限的类似发现的能力,用于经由运行时间代理读取元数据和操作数据或监控专用应用或系统。集成中间件(例如,企业应用集成、企业服务总线、和/或SOA应用)还可以具有用于内容开发和操作的设计和管理工具。这些工具还可以创建元数据和/或方便已有信息的一些发现。这里提供的一些实施例在发现处理期间独立于各种源系统地将元数据带进(bringinto)公共表现。然后,可以在合并处理中执行一组基于规则的算法,以识别该信息之间的类似性和关系。根据一些实施例,可以基本上以实时方式执行处理。虽然在任何给定时间点所述集成网络可以表示特定状态的信息源的快照,但是所述发现和合并处理可以随着时间而不断地执行(因为集成网络可能随着源被添加、去除或改变而持续地演进)。业务网络管理的目标包括渐落集成开发的点对点生命周期、并允许对不同信息的协作以进行更快的执行。因此,有用的网络景观可以利用应用和集成总线/企业服务总线来反映客户景观的概括视图。而且,网络的视图可需要自动地构建并且利用实际生产系统最新地生存,以保证网络的可见度和透明度。发现网络的处理可以使用合并的和源信息模型以及信息的分析来探索系统景观,以找到信息中的类似性和关系。由于集成技术被用作应用之间的中间物(intermediary)(并因此具有关于应用的集成终点的元数据),所以网络的探索可以以集成技术开始。对于具有代理者(proxy)和连通性的应用,所述信息可以包括连通性和接口细节和/或操作数据。对于具有代理者、连通性、以及中介(mediation)的应用,所述信息可以包括连通性和接口细节、映射、路由、和/或操作数据。对于独立企业服务总线或集成服务器,所述信息可以包括连通性和接口细节、映射、路由、系统中心的处理、和/或操作数据。对于连接到独立企业服务总线或集成服务器的应用,所述信息可以包括连通性和/或操作数据。对于B2B网关,所述信息可以包括连通性和接口细节、映射、路由、系统中心的处理、和/或操作本文档来自技高网...
用于业务网络管理发现和合并的系统和方法

【技术保护点】

【技术特征摘要】
2010.11.11 US 12/944,0061.一种计算机实现的方法,包括:在网络景观中发现多个互连的实体;将所述实体的子集自动地合并到业务参与者中,其中所述合并根据至少一个基于规则的算法来执行;以及生成包括所述业务参与者的业务处理景观,其中,被合并到业务处理景观中的业务参与者中的所述实体的子集中的实体之一是系统;其中,所述在网络景观中发现多个互连的实体包括:发现关于被合并到业务处理景观中的业务参与者中的所述实体的子集的信息,所发现的关于被合并到业务参与者中的所述实体的子集的信息包括所述系统的多个源模型和多个不同的表示;并且其中,所述将所述实体的子集自动地合并到业务参与者中包括:根据所述至少一个基于规则的算法来执行所述源模型之间的类似性检测和关系确定。2.如权利要求1所述的方法,其中,所述实体中的至少一些与以下各项中的至少一个相关联:(i)业务应用、(ii)业务系统、(iii)文件系统、(iv)数据库管理系统、或(v)企业资源计划系统。3.如权利要求1所述的方法,其中,所述发现步骤包括分析传入呼叫配置信息和传出呼叫配置信息。4.如权利要求3所述的方法,其中,所述发现步骤至少部分地基于从操作者接收的信息。5.如权利要求1所述的方法,其中,所述合并步骤至少部分地基于匹配、类似性、或关系分析。6.如权利要求5所述的方法,其中,所述合并步骤至少部分地基于从操作者接收的信息。7.如权利要求1所述的方法,其中,所述算法包括试探性的算法。8.如权利要求1所述的方法,其中,所述算法至少部分地基于:(i)应用系统概观、(ii)产品版本、(iii)连通性信息、(iv)在中间件系统或应用系统上运行的集成、(v)接口、(vi)集成处理模型、(vii)操作数据、(viii)业务处理描述、(ix)业务角色和参与者、(x)业务对话、或(xi)业务协作。9.如权利要求1所述的方法,其中,所述发现步骤和所述合并步骤被基本上实时地执行。10.如...

【专利技术属性】
技术研发人员:A巴特D里特J丹纳T维斯特曼
申请(专利权)人:SAP股份公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1
相关领域技术